Habeck Calls for Preservation Amid VW Crisis

Employees of German car maker Volkswagen (VW) protest at the start of a company's general meeting in Wolfsburg, northern Germany, on September 4, 2024.
In response to the crisis at Volkswagen, Federal Minister of Economic Affairs Robert Habeck has urged the company to maintain all its production sites while signaling political support. During his visit to the VW plant in Emden, Habeck emphasized the importance of preserving these locations. He also announced an automotive summit for Monday to discuss the industry's current challenges, including the slow sales of electric vehicles (EVs).
